SHAKESPEARE was such an amazing sonneteer that there is actually a TYPE of sonnet today that we refer to as a "Shakespearean Sonnet"! ... Quite simply, a Shakespearean sonnet contains fourteen lines of iambic PENTAMETER. It has THREE quatrains (FOUR lines each) and a final rhyming couplet (of two lines).
